Alex Rodriguez Park at Mark Light Field: A Beacon of College Baseball Excellence

Alex Rodriguez Park at Mark Light Field stands as a cornerstone of University of Miami athletics, nestled on the vibrant Coral Gables campus. Opened on February 16, 1973, this iconic venue marked its inaugural game with a thrilling 5-1 victory over Florida State, drawing 4,235 enthusiastic fans who witnessed a rare triple play. Originally named Mark Light Field after a dedicated University of Miami supporter, the stadium honors the legacy of George Light, whose contributions funded its construction.

With a capacity of 5,000 spectators, the park offers intimate views of the action, featuring dimensions that challenge hitters: 330 feet to left and right fields, 365 feet to the gaps, and a deep 400 feet to center. Its turf and lighting have evolved through renovations, ensuring top-tier play. A pivotal $3.9 million donation from former New York Yankees star Alex Rodriguez, a Hurricanes alum and 14-time All-Star, spurred major upgrades from 2007 to 2009. These enhancements included a new hitting backstop, advanced sound system, and improved fan amenities, solidifying its status as a premier college baseball facility.

Home to the Miami Hurricanes, the park has hosted 27 NCAA Regionals since 1977, fostering national championships and legendary moments. The Hurricanes' storied program, with multiple College World Series titles, thrives here amid the electric atmosphere. Beyond games, it symbolizes resilience and community, drawing alumni and fans to celebrate Miami's baseball heritage. As the Hurricanes continue to compete at the highest level, Alex Rodriguez Park remains a testament to passion, innovation, and unyielding spirit in collegiate sports.


Pro Turning Tips & FAQ: Master Your Stadium Seat Creations

Transform your blanks into showstoppers with these pro-level insights. Our upgraded V2 blanks boast finer shredded plastic for ultra-smooth turning and minimal chip-out— a game-changer over V1. Dial in sharp carbide or HSS tools, crank speeds to 2,000–3,000 RPM, and take feather-light cuts (0.005–0.015 inches) to dodge melting or gummy buildup.
